Understanding the IELTS 6.0 Benchmark

A band 6.0 in IELTS signifies that you are a “competent user” of the English language. This means:

  • You can understand and communicate effectively in most everyday situations.
  • You can handle complex language and understand detailed reasoning, though with occasional inaccuracies.
  • You can participate in discussions on familiar topics and express your opinions with clarity.

Effective Strategies to Score 6.0 in IELTS

Reaching a 6.0 in IELTS requires a targeted approach across all four sections: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Here’s a breakdown of key strategies for each section:

Listening:

  • Sharpen your note-taking skills: Practice listening for specific information and jotting down key points.
  • Familiarize yourself with different accents: Listen to recordings in various English accents to improve comprehension.
  • Utilize the time given wisely: Use the time provided to preview questions and anticipate potential answers.

Reading:

  • Master skimming and scanning techniques: Learn to quickly identify the main ideas and specific details within passages.
  • Expand your vocabulary: Regularly learn new words and practice using them in context.
  • Pay attention to question types: Understand the different question formats and develop appropriate strategies for each.

Writing:

  • Structure your writing effectively: Practice organizing your ideas logically and using cohesive devices to connect paragraphs.
  • Develop your grammar and vocabulary: Work on using a variety of grammatical structures and vocabulary accurately and appropriately.
  • Understand the task requirements: Carefully analyze the question prompts to ensure you address all parts of the task.

Speaking:

  • Speak fluently and naturally: Focus on speaking at a steady pace and connecting your ideas smoothly.
  • Use a wide range of vocabulary and grammar: Demonstrate your language proficiency by using diverse vocabulary and grammatical structures.
  • Express your opinions clearly and confidently: Don’t be afraid to share your thoughts and justify your viewpoints.

Illustrative Examples from IELTS Practice Tests:

Listening: In a conversation about a museum tour, a key detail could be the starting time or meeting point.

Reading: A passage about renewable energy might require you to identify the author’s main argument or the advantages of a specific energy source.

Writing: You may be asked to write an essay discussing the benefits and drawbacks of technology in education.

Speaking: A common topic is describing your hometown, including its location, attractions, and what you like most about it.

Top Tips to Maximize Your Score:

  • Practice regularly with authentic materials: Utilize past IELTS papers and sample tests to simulate exam conditions.
  • Seek feedback from experienced tutors: Get personalized guidance and identify areas for improvement.
  • Record yourself speaking and analyze your performance: This helps identify areas where fluency, pronunciation, or grammar can be enhanced.
  • Stay motivated and persistent: Achieving a 6.0 takes time and effort, so remain dedicated to your learning journey.
